速卖通素材
努力

2g内存的服务器适合多少用户?

服务器

对于2GB内存的服务器而言,其支持的用户数量主要取决于应用类型、服务器配置(如CPU、磁盘I/O等)、应用程序的优化程度以及用户的活跃度等因素。一般情况下,如果应用是轻量级的(例如简单的博客或静态网站),这样的服务器可以支持数百个并发用户。但如果应用较为复杂(如在线游戏、大型数据库查询等),则可能只能支持几十个甚至更少的并发用户。

具体来说,服务器的性能与用户需求之间的匹配是一个动态平衡的过程。首先,从硬件角度来看,2GB内存对于现代服务器而言并不算大,尤其是在处理多任务或多用户请求时。内存大小直接影响到服务器能够同时处理的数据量和运行的应用程序数量。例如,一个简单的WordPress站点可能只需要几十MB的内存来运行,但由于访问量的增加,特别是当有多个用户同时进行操作时,内存的需求会迅速上升。此外,如果使用了缓存机制(如Redis或Memcached),这些服务本身也会占用一部分内存资源。

其次,软件层面的优化也是决定2GB内存服务器能支持多少用户的关键因素之一。高效的代码编写、合理的数据库设计、恰当的缓存策略以及对第三方服务的有效利用等,都能显著提高服务器的承载能力。例如,通过减少不必要的HTTP请求、压缩文件传输、使用CDN分发静态资源等手段,可以有效减轻服务器的压力,使得相同配置下能够支持更多的用户。

最后,还需要考虑的是用户的行为模式。如果大多数用户只是偶尔访问,且每次访问的时间较短,那么即使是在高流量时期,服务器也能够较好地应对。相反,如果用户群体中有大量持续在线或频繁交互的用户,那么即使是较小规模的用户基数,也可能给服务器带来较大的压力。

综上所述,2GB内存的服务器能够支持的具体用户数量没有固定答案,需要根据实际应用场景来判断。为了确保良好的用户体验并实现资源的有效利用,建议在项目初期就充分考虑以上各方面因素,并通过负载测试等方式,逐步调整优化方案,以达到最佳的服务效果。

未经允许不得转载:轻量云Cloud » 2g内存的服务器适合多少用户?